Multilevel Inverter Project with Simulation and Results in Tirunelveli
Multilevel Inverters (MLIs) are advanced power electronic converters that generate high-quality AC output voltage from multiple DC voltage sources. Compared to conventional inverters, multilevel inverters offer reduced harmonic distortion, improved efficiency, lower switching losses, and enhanced power quality. These advantages make them highly suitable for renewable energy systems, industrial motor drives, electric vehicles, smart grids, and high-voltage power applications.

Applications of Multilevel Inverter Projects
Multilevel inverters are widely used in modern electrical and power electronic systems where high-quality AC power generation is required. Renewable energy systems such as solar and wind power plants use multilevel inverters to efficiently convert DC power into grid-compatible AC power.
Industrial motor drives utilize multilevel inverters to achieve smooth speed control, reduced harmonics, and improved energy efficiency. Electric vehicles employ advanced inverter technologies to enhance motor performance and battery utilization. Smart grid infrastructures depend on multilevel inverters for integrating distributed energy resources and maintaining power quality.
Multilevel inverter systems are also used in high-voltage transmission systems, railway electrification, industrial automation, aerospace applications, UPS systems, and energy storage systems. Their ability to produce near-sinusoidal output waveforms makes them highly valuable in modern power conversion applications.
